sma: support bdev-based QoS for NVMe/vfiouser devices

test/sma verifies that bdev-based QoS settings are correctly applied on
vfio-user devices.

def set_qos(self, request):
nqn = request.device_handle[len(f'{self._prefix}:'):]
volume = format_volume_id(request.volume_id)
if volume is None:
raise DeviceException(grpc.StatusCode.INVALID_ARGUMENT,
'Invalid volume ID')
try:
with self._client() as client:
# Make sure that a volume exists and is attached to the device
bdev = self._get_bdev(client, volume)
if bdev is None:
raise DeviceException(grpc.StatusCode.NOT_FOUND,
'No volume associated with volume_id could be found')
subsys = self._get_subsys(client, nqn)
if subsys is None:
raise DeviceException(grpc.StatusCode.NOT_FOUND,
'No device associated with device_handle could be found')
ns = self._get_ns(bdev, subsys)
if ns is None:
raise DeviceException(grpc.StatusCode.INVALID_ARGUMENT,
'Specified volume is not attached to the device')
qos.set_volume_bdev_qos(client, request)
except qos.QosException as ex:
raise DeviceException(ex.code, ex.message)
except JSONRPCException:
raise DeviceException(grpc.StatusCode.INTERNAL,
'Failed to set QoS')
def get_qos_capabilities(self, request):
return qos.get_bdev_qos_capabilities()
